Blueprint for Success – In this role you’ll need to…

  • Budget and forecast costs and volumes of raw materials
  • Hire, train, and manage performance of staff
  • Negotiate and supervise various contracts including logging, road construction, and transportation
  • Appraise and negotiate or bid private and government timber sale purchases
  • Monitor and report accomplishments and compare to budgets/goals
  • Ensure delivery of raw materials to mills meeting quality, quantity, and cost objectives
  • Provide timely information and participation in Mill Business Team decisions
  • Provide leadership to less experienced Resource Managers
  • Perform all duties in accordance with safety rules and regulations
